I rent the basement of a house in the Greater Toronto Area, and my lease specifies that I am entitled to one parking space, without specifying exactly which one. The house has five parking spaces in total: two in the enclosed garage, three in the driveway (two adjacent to the garage), and the last one separated by a sidewalk, which, when parked lengthwise, blocks the other two. My landlord told me I must use the space adjacent to the sidewalk from 2:00 a.m. to 6:00 a.m., and during the day I park on the street because he doesn't want his cars blocked. I know that the city allows parking on the street during the day and until 2:00 a.m., but I wonder if I actually have a parking space as stipulated in my lease? Especially since there are often incidents or collisions with cars parked on the street, which are more likely to be hit.
